Heritage Icons Photography Auction Showcases Signed Mikan Rookie Card Photo

Heritage Auctions has unveiled a stunning collection of autographed vintage photographs in its latest Icons Photography Auction, sparking excitement among sports memorabilia enthusiasts and collectors. One of the most coveted items up for bidding is a 1948 photo featuring basketball legend George Mikan in action, the same image mirrored on his iconic 1948 Bowman rookie card. This 8×10 Type 1 photo, enhanced with Mikan’s signature in blue ink, is projected to command a price of over $20,000.

The theme of signed vintage photos resonates throughout the auction, with a late 1940s image capturing Cleveland Browns icon Otto Graham, reminiscent of his 1950 Bowman Football rookie card, also bearing his signature. Furthermore, a remarkable autographed photo from 1949 showcases Jackie Robinson receiving his Silver Bat for clinching the National League batting title, a season in which he was crowned MVP. This Type I photo, personalized to “Jeff,” holds particular significance for aficionados.

Another poignant photograph from 1957 portrays Robinson clearing out his locker at Ebbets Field upon his retirement from baseball. The image captures poignant details of his Dodgers cap, home jersey, fielder’s glove, cleats, and equipment bag, alongside two bats—one of which once belonged to the legendary Gil Hodges. Anticipated to attract bids exceeding $10,000, this piece encapsulates a poignant moment in baseball history.

Noteworthy in the auction is a photo believed to have been used for Willie Mays’ 1952 Topps card, complete with Mays’ signature on the front, purportedly signed in the 1990s.

The online catalog of the auction showcases a diverse array of over 150 vintage images, some dating back more than a century. Notable among these is a photo from the 1919 World Series capturing the historic moment when Black Sox pitcher Eddie Cicotte and Reds’ starter Dutch Reuther shook hands before the infamous game at Redland Field in Cincinnati. This image, furnished with the original paper caption and stamps on the back, is slated to commence bidding at $8,000.

Moreover, the auction spotlights rookie photos of sports luminaries such as Hank Aaron (1954), Jack Nicklaus (1962), and Pete Maravich (1970), alongside various images portraying the iconic figures of Babe Ruth, Lou Gehrig, and other pre-war sports legends.
